Abstract

An Spulmaschinen und dergleichen entstehen bei Nach­ lassen der Fadenspannung Kringel. Durch Verringerung des Winkels α des Fadens (25) zur Spulenstirnfläche (213) kann die Reibung des Faden (25) an der Spulenkante soweit erhöht wer­ den, dass auch bei Nachlassen der Fadenspannung sich keine Windungen auf der Spulenoberfläche ablösen und verkringeln. Die Verringerung des Winkels α kann durch Absenken der Fa­ denöse (24) auf die Spule (23) zu, durch Anheben der Spule (23) oder durch Umlenken des Fadens (25) an einem Fortsatz (4, 14) auf der Spule (23) erreicht werden.
Beim Umlenken des Fadens (23) an einem Fortsatz (4, 14) kann durch gegensinnig zu der Spulenwicklung am Fortsatz (4, 14) angebrachter Windungen eine einfach aufzulösende Fa­ denreserve vorgesehen werden, welche als Ganzes oder ab­ schnittweise ausgezogen werden kann.
